Negro Antônio sits in Goiás, Brazil and is identified as a hamlet. Negro Antônio maps to -15.573°, -48.840° — squarely within the tropical belt. Detailed population figures are not currently catalogued in the open data sources we track. Climatically, locations at this latitude tend to experience warm temperatures throughout the year with pronounced wet and dry seasons. Open solar datasets indicate about 2,012 kWh/m² of solar irradiance per year, combined with sunshine for roughly 79% of daylight hours.
